You’ll Be Responsible For:
- Chart of accounts maintenance and integrity.
- Support on Payroll-GL accounting and transformation.
- Support intercompany reconciliations and revaluations.
- Lease accounting.
- Investment accounting.
- Support on transformation of balance sheet reconciliation process.
- Owner for Oracle chart of account changes.
- Support external audits.
- Support on working capital deep dives/insight.
- Supporting the group team on ad hoc responsibilities.
You’ll Need To Have:
- Professional accounting qualification e.g. ACA, ACCA, CIMA, (or equivalent) qualification.
- Practise trained ideally big 10 firm.
- Experience using Oracle ERP is highly beneficial.
- Experience of month end close processes.
- Excellent analytical skills and a meticulous approach to problem solving.
- Proactive mind set.
